Q: Is 20,156,977 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 20,156,977 is a composite number.

Why is 20,156,977 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 20,156,977 can be evenly divided by 1 269 74,933 and 20,156,977, with no remainder.

Since 20,156,977 cannot be divided by just 1 and 20,156,977, it is a composite number.
